About 2 months ago, I purchased a pre-owned Navi World and ordered a Galactic 32 Sleek (for the Wife). Prior to picking my wife's watch, I noticed that the slide rule was not lining up with the dial. It was off enough to really bother me and it was one of those things that once you noticed it, you couldn't un-notice it. When I went to pick my Wife's watch, I showed my AD the issues. He actually offered to take the watch back, but he said before he would go that route, he would make a call. I assumed he was either calling his watch smith or BUSA. Given the watch was pre-owned, I really didn't think BUSA would do much, so I really thought he was getting a price from his watch smith to fix the slide rule. About 5 minutes later, two gentlemen walked in the store and he said that was who he had called. To my surprise, it was the President of BUSA and one of the Regional Sales Reps, who just happened to be in town and right down the road. He showed my watch to both of them, explained the issue, of which both agreed that this was QC mistake on Breitling's behalf. The Regional Sales Rep came over to me, said he would take care of the watch because Breitling prides themselves in having accurate and correct time pieces. I was in complete shock and could not believe how lucky I had just gotten. Breitling USA did in fact repair the watch as well as a basic service to the watch at no cost to me or my AD and turned it around in about 4 weeks. I have always been a fan of Breitling and jesters/customer service like this will keep me purchasing their watches for years to come.

I can add to this...dropped my B50 at the NYC boutique for a very unusual problem, it would lose 5-6 seconds after setting and stay that just far behind. It was not user error, as I duplicated it many times against two atomic clock apps. The battery life was an issue as well. A charge would last forever but when it got to about 30%, it would just shut down. The watch was out of warranty by a week or two but BUSA covered it with no issue and I should get it back within a month of dropping it off. Other than these two problems, the watch has been a brilliant travel companion and multiple time zones are easily managed.
